Transaction 1062243064f3f6868007fec382434a640be2b00371225236619c094322398876
1 Input
1 Output
-
1062243064f3f6868007fec382434a640be2b00371225236619c094322398876:0
- value
- 363066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a846fd39d040db32a69d556249dfb5917ed4d05 OP_EQUAL
- address
- 3EKRptTsFsk1Ms7QRS7wrVhRQ8LNux9XV4